I've been there numerous times to get my regular 'fix' of Malaysian food. Overall, the food is OK, although I normally order their combination noodle with green pickled chillies, which I find is close to the version found in Malaysia. The rest of the food is generally OK, although I would probably avoid getting the already cooked food from their hot bar as I find them to be dry (sign of being there for too long).

Not much of an ambience, just a place to eat your food and leave. Service is very mix, at times the staffs are attentive, but mostly, the service is bad. Some of the staffs are not friendly and seemed pretty moody. The food are not too pricey, most of them are between $8-$10, but I wouldn't rate them as value of money.

Having lived in Singapore I go here for a quick kind of hawker centre fix. Their combination hor fun, they call it something else, is pretty authentic if you ask for lots of green chillies. Their rotis with curry are nice too but sometimes they burn them. I am wanting to try the murtabak, I am yet to find good ones in Sydney. Most of the other stuff is pretty average, but good hawker food is hard to find here so it's better than nothing and it isn't expensive at all.
